Sat 412340637043924

decimal
82468.637043924
degree
0°82468′1828″637043924‴
percentile
19.635268452261855%
name
kxuowvqxppl
cycle
0
epoch
0
period
40
block
82468
offset
637043924
timestamp
rarity
common
inscriptions
location
8154ca4f9eef9e59537d60e418a8ef9f007ed56a5095188aa02c4af184c72880:0:0
address
bc1qcmj5lkumeycyn35lxc3yr32k3fzue87yrjrna6